disneyd wrote:I'm really surprised someone hasn't figured out how to emulate OBD/CANBUS output on the Megasquirts.
There are options, from Aim type dases to bluetooth tablets. The problem is getting the data to overlay properly with your action cam. I have not seen many successfully do it, but, that could possibly be because I don't have a large network of people that are on racetracks. Most everyone I know usually only autocrosses. There are a few people I see with telemetry for autocross but they are either using some sort of datalogging (AiM, Racepak, ect.) equipment or their action cam supports it.

On the Hydra they had an update that basically emulated CAN output for boost pressure, rpm, etc., and the third party Bluetooth/WiFi adapters didn't know the difference. I'll bet it's doable on the MS if the right person got interested in it.
